What Is High Solid Epoxy Coating: Protecting Your Concrete from Weather Damage?
High Solid Epoxy Coating is a premium liquid product formulated to penetrate deeply into porous concrete surfaces. Unlike traditional sealers, it forms a dense, impermeable barrier that blocks moisture, chemicals, and stains. The “high solid” aspect means minimal volatile organic compounds (VOCs), faster curing times, and superior film strength.
It works on various concrete applications—driveways, patios, garage floors, basements, and even commercial spaces like warehouses and factories. Whether you’re seeking a glossy finish or a low-sheen look, there’s a formulation tailored to your needs.

Types of High Solid Epoxy Coating: Protecting Your Concrete from Weather Damage (Explained Simply)
Understanding the options helps you make the right choice:
Penetrating Sealers
- Soak into pores rather than forming a surface layer.
- Ideal for preserving breathability in older or historic concrete.
- Less glossy but excellent for moisture control.
Acrylic Sealers
- Water-based, easy cleanup, and fast-drying.
- Offer moderate stain resistance and UV protection.
- Suited for indoor garages and light-duty outdoor areas.
Epoxy Coatings
- High solids, durable, and chemical-resistant.
- Provide full coverage and a hard-wearing finish.
- Best for driveways, patios, and high-traffic zones.
Polyurethane Coatings
- Flexible, slip-resistant, and UV-stable.
- Often used for commercial settings requiring slip safety.
Each type balances performance, aesthetics, and cost differently. Select based on your environment and priorities.

How to Choose the Right High Solid Epoxy Coating: Protecting Your Concrete from Weather Damage
Selecting the best option depends on several factors:
- Surface Type: Driveways need more wear resistance; patios may prioritize aesthetics.
- Climate: Freeze-thaw regions benefit from flexible, crack-resistant formulas.
- Traffic Level: Heavy vehicle or foot traffic calls for thicker, more durable coatings.
- Desired Finish: Matte for a natural look, glossy for easy cleaning.
- Budget: Higher solids often mean better performance per gallon, potentially lowering costs long-term.
Always check manufacturer specs and compatibility with your existing concrete.

How to Apply High Solid Epoxy Coating: Protecting Your Concrete from Weather Damage (Step-by-Step)
Surface Preparation
1. Clean thoroughly—remove dirt, grease, and old coatings.
2. Repair cracks and holes using appropriate fillers.
3. Allow complete drying before proceeding.
Tools Needed
- Power washer
- Scrapers, grinders, or sanders
- Trowel or roller applicator
- Paint rollers or squeegees
- Personal protective equipment (PPE)
Application Process
1. Mix according to instructions.
2. Apply thin, even coats using a roller or brush.
3. Allow proper curing between layers (typically 4–8 hours).
4. Final coat may require a longer cure time.
Drying and Curing
- Full hardness achieved in 24–48 hours.
- Full chemical resistance after 72 hours.
Safety Tips
- Work in well-ventilated areas.
- Wear gloves, goggles, and respirators if recommended.

Common Mistakes to Avoid
- Skipping Surface Prep: Dirt and loose particles lead to poor adhesion.
- Applying Too Thick/Thin: Both can cause uneven curing or reduced durability.
- Wrong Product Selection: Match coating type to your environment.
- Poor Timing: Avoid application during rain or extreme temperatures.
- Over-Application: Excess product wastes time and money; follow manufacturer guidelines.
---
Maintenance and Reapplication
A well-applied High Solid Epoxy Coating can last 5–15 years depending on conditions. To maximize lifespan:
- Sweep regularly to prevent grit buildup.
- Clean with pH-neutral solutions.
- Address spills promptly to avoid staining.
- Inspect annually for cracks or wear.
Reseal when you notice loss of sheen or increased absorption.

Common Questions About High Solid Epoxy Coating: Protecting Your Concrete from Weather Damage
Q: Can I walk on the surface immediately after application?
A: Most products allow foot traffic after 4–6 hours, but full cure takes up to 48 hours.
Q: Will it change the color of my concrete?
A: Some coatings offer tinted options. Others preserve the original look while enhancing depth.
Q: Is it safe for food prep areas?
A: Yes, especially if you select non-toxic, food-grade formulations.
Q: How do I fix small chips or scratches?
A: Lightly sand and apply a touch-up coat matching the original finish.
Q: Can I paint over it?
A: Only if the surface is fully cured and compatible with paint systems designed for epoxy.
